The only people that fear an audit are those that have something to hide. If you have good records it shouldn't be a problem like Robert said.  I don't see how preparing the taxes would hurt.  You could always go back and correct any discrepancies prior to submitting. 

I do remember my husband telling me that if you are under a certain dollar amount (which escapes me now) they don't have to 1099 you.  Not sure if that is true and We still made sure to claim the income.  He kept great records of his closings even tho he did not use any accounting programs or computer tracking.  A simple invoice book and mileage/expense log did the trick, altho he was pretty small time compared to some other Contract Closers I know.  

Good luck tracking them down but I wouldn't hold my breath.
